Over 20,000 Kashmiri Muslims converted to Christianity

GNS REPORT : Over 20,000 Kashmiri Muslims are reported to have converted to Christianity since the inception of militancy in 1990. Information gathered from various sources reveal that Christian missionaries made their way into Kashmir in a big way soon after the armed turmoil hit the state and tried to reach out to what Christianity Today-an evangelical periodical-said (in a report on September 9, 2002) war-weary Muslims in Kashmir. The periodical put the number of neo-Christian then to 15000.  The conversions are likely to have surged past 20,000 with over a dozen Christian missions and churches based in the US, Germany, the Netherlands and Switzerland operating in the state. Violence against women on the rise in Jammu, 605 cases registered last year

Tahir Mushtaq  GNS JAMMU : Domestic violence again women are on the rise in Jammu and Kashmir. Even the educated and the economically independent women are at the receiving end, according to anecdotal evidence contained in police data.  Police figures show an increase in domestic violence cases, mostly relating to matrimonial disputes and family squabbles. Harassment for dowry too is one of the most common complaints lodged with the police, data shows.  Comparing the figures in 2010-2011 the city witnessed a total of 1100 cases of domestic violence but this time till end of 2011, nearly 605 cases have been reported in the Women Cell of the police.  As per the data, about 400 domestic violence cases have been sorted out after mutual compromise while FIR has been registered in 14 cases at Women Cell, Canal Road. Rethinking Religious Conversion in Kashmir

By : Mushtaq Ul Haq Ahmad Sikandar   Kashmir has been a Muslim majority region since many centuries now. Islam was spread in Kashmir by peaceful Preachings of Sufis and Rishism. In the words of eminent historian Prem Nath Bazaz "Politics had dehumanized the kashmiris, Islam made them men again. Just as the Muslim rule was established in Kashmir without much bloodshed, so was Islam spread throughout the length and breadth of the valley by Peaceful preaching and lucid persuasions of Mir Sayyid Ali and hundreds of the Sayyid missionaries who came from Hamadan and other parts of Persia".  Thus the Islam in Kashmir has its own indigenous character. The majority of Muslims deeply revere and love their faith, at times quite fanatically. Shoe thrown at Rahul Gandhi during a rally in Dehradun

GNS Dehradun: A shoe has been thrown at Congress General Secretary and Amethi MP Rahul Gandhi during an election rally in Dehradun. One person has been detained for throwing the shoe.Rahul Gandhi said that such attacks were not going to deter him."If some people think that throwing a shoe will deter me and force me to run away, them they are mistaken. Rahul Gandhi will not run away," he said.
